VHDL Highlighting

Kate

Source (link to git-repo or to original if based on someone elses unmodified work): Add the source-code for this project on opencode.net

0
Score 50.0%
Description:

In newer KDE versions the syntax highlighting for VHDL is already included (see http://websvn.kde.org/*checkout*/trunk/KDE/kdelibs/kate/syntax/data/vhdl.xml for the current svn version).

If your kate release does not have VHDL support, just download the file vhdl.xml and save it in the directory ~/.kde/share/apps/katepart/syntax/
Last changelog:

9 years ago

== 1.08 ==
Lots of changes by Jan Michel:
* for/while loops can be collapsed and expanded
* generate blocks can be collapsed and expanded
* procedural statements are recognized in generate blocks
* recognition of optional keywords and labels improved
* number of "false positives" has been reduced

== 1.07 ==
* small fix to be valid against the DTD
* officially integrated into kate

== 1.06 ==
Add collapse and expand blocks for:
* entity
* component
* component instances
* case

== 1.05 ==
Add collapse and expand blocks for:
* architecture
* process
* for
* while
* if

== 1.04 ==
Original vhdl.xml from KDE svn written by Rocky Scaletta.

C

xylo

9 years ago

I tested the "wait for" statement in a small VHDL file, but I could not discover any problems in kate 2.5.11. Maybe your version of the vhdl.xml is too old for this. I suggest you to update the file to the current svn version (see link above). I think, you have to overwrite the old file to update it. An additional installation in your local $KDEHOME directory might not be sufficient.

If the bug still appears after the update, I suggest you to write an email to the kwrite mailing list, since I'm not maintaining the file anymore.

Good luck!

Report

9 years ago

== 1.08 ==
Lots of changes by Jan Michel:
* for/while loops can be collapsed and expanded
* generate blocks can be collapsed and expanded
* procedural statements are recognized in generate blocks
* recognition of optional keywords and labels improved
* number of "false positives" has been reduced

== 1.07 ==
* small fix to be valid against the DTD
* officially integrated into kate

== 1.06 ==
Add collapse and expand blocks for:
* entity
* component
* component instances
* case

== 1.05 ==
Add collapse and expand blocks for:
* architecture
* process
* for
* while
* if

== 1.04 ==
Original vhdl.xml from KDE svn written by Rocky Scaletta.

12345678910
product-maker Base: 4 x 5.0 Ratings
File (click to download) Version Description Downloads Date Filesize DL OCS-Install MD5SUM
*Needs ocs-url or ocs-store to install things
Pling
0 Affiliates
Details
license
version
1.08
updated Sep 11 2010
added May 14 2007
downloads 24h
0
page views 24h 1
System Tags addon